Output 3e44a2d800b85aed2ae65cd024632aaa1475d21889f4fcd36e8ee2b7a3841dee:75

value
669228
script pubkey
OP_0 OP_PUSHBYTES_32 4da33e6b861c98cfd239cb82f2c62579b86fa4b78e1bcfa98718e2a94eefe178
address
bc1qfk3nu6uxrjvvl53eewp093390xuxlf9h3cdul2v8rr32jnh0u9uq2ttp3h
transaction
3e44a2d800b85aed2ae65cd024632aaa1475d21889f4fcd36e8ee2b7a3841dee
confirmations
38195
spent
true